People who have mesothelioma typically work in environments in which asbestos is present. They could have worked in critical manufacturing facilities, as insulation workers, or at shipyards where asbestos was used to construct ships, pipes and other equipment. They could have been directly exposed to asbestos materials, or have become sick from breathing in contaminated air or laundering work clothing that had come into contact with asbestos dust.

Mesothelioma cases can be filed as personal injury claims or lawsuits for wrongful death. There could be multiple defendants involved, as asbestos-related companies have been acknowledged to have supplied various asbestos-related products in different states. Mesothelioma lawyers will look at the asbestos company's corporate records to determine where asbestos exposure took place and at what time. They will then decide the best state to file the claim in.

A lawsuit can be settled outside of court or tried in court. However, the majority of mesothelioma lawsuits are settled out of court. This is because the majority of asbestos compensation companies are unable defend themselves against a mesothelioma lawsuit and will compensate victims to avoid a lengthy trial.

The jury will decide the amount each victim receives when a lawsuit is tried. The damages are usually divided into two categories: economic and noneconomic damages. Economic damages refer to treatment costs such as lost wages, medical expenses and other expenses incurred in connection to the diagnosis. Noneconomic damages are based on the plaintiff's pain and suffering and can be granted in addition to economic damage awards.
